冷源等离子体冷杀菌技术及其在食品中的应用研究 被引量:20

Disinfection Technology of Cold Plasma and its Application in Food

摘要 冷源等离子体是气体在高电压作用下高度电离的混合物,混合物中多种活性基团和粒子能够与微生物体中的多种成分发生发应,从而阻碍微生物的正常生长,最终导致死亡,反应过程中温度无明显变化。冷源等离子体作为一种冷杀菌方法,在食品杀菌工业中具有广阔的应用前景。对冷源等离子体的发生、产生系统以及等离子体中的活性作用物质进行了综述,并介绍了冷源等离子体在食品中的应用研究。 Cold plasma is a mixture with high ionized state at atmospheric pressure. Within the mixture,there are lots of active species and particles which can attack the cells of microorganism to control their normal growth and lead to death. But there is no significant temperature changes during this reaction process. As a non-thermal sterilization method,cold plasma has a broad prospect of application in food disinfection industry. This paper briefly introduced the generation of cold plasma,their emerging system and major reactive species. The paper also introduced the research activities about cold plasma application in food industry.
